Natalie Curtis
Natalie Curtis Burlin (born April 26, 1875 in New York City, New York – died October 23, 1921) was an American ethnomusicologist. Curtis, along with Alice Cunningham Fletcher and Frances Densmore, was one of a small group of women doing important ethnological studies in North America at the beginning of the 20th century.
